Nestled in a pretty cul-de-sac close to the town centre, renowned local schools, and the scenic expanses of Southwood Country Park, this beautifully presented two-bedroom home offers a rare blend of convenience and charm.
Inside, the property reveals a spacious lounge, a well-appointed kitchen/breakfast room, two comfortable bedrooms, and a bathroom. It has also been thoughtfully upgraded, featuring double glazing installed three years ago and a new boiler fitted just last year — both accompanied by ten-year guarantees, offering peace of mind for years to come.
Outdoors, enjoy a private rear garden and the added benefit of dedicated parking.
Commuters will appreciate the excellent transport links, with Farnborough Mainline Station offering swift access to London Waterloo in just 38 minutes. Junctions 4 and 4a of the M3 are also easily reachable, streamlining travel by road.
